Sixty percent of people with acute interstitial pneumonitis will die in the first six months of illness. [3] The median survival is 1 + 1 ⁄ 2 months. However, most people who have one episode do not have a second. People who survive often recover lung function completely. [citation needed]

Idiopathic interstitial pneumonia (IIP), or noninfectious pneumonia [1] are a class of diffuse lung diseases. These diseases typically affect the pulmonary interstitium, although some also have a component affecting the airways (for instance, cryptogenic organizing pneumonitis). There are seven recognized distinct subtypes of IIP. [2]
The fibrosing pattern of NSIP has a five-year survival rate of 86% to 92%, while the cellular pattern of NSIP has a 100% five-year survival rate. Patients with NSIP (whether cellular or fibrosing), have a better prognosis than those with usual interstitial pneumonia (UIP).
Usual interstitial pneumonia (UIP) is a form of lung disease characterized by progressive scarring of both lungs. [1] The scarring (pulmonary fibrosis) involves the pulmonary interstitium (the supporting framework of the lung). UIP is thus classified as a form of interstitial lung disease.
Pulmonary function testing in people with organizing pneumonia, either cryptogenic or due to secondary causes, shows a restrictive defect with a decrease in the gas absorptive capacity of the lungs (seen as a decrease in the diffusion capacity of carbon monoxide). [9] Airflow obstruction is usually not seen on pulmonary function testing. [9]
Desquamative interstitial pneumonia (DIP) is a type of idiopathic interstitial pneumonia featuring elevated numbers of macrophages within the alveoli of the lung. [1] DIP is a chronic disorder with an insidious onset. Its common symptoms include shortness of breath, coughing, fever, weakness, weight loss, and fatigue.
